Judy Johns, 72, born June 30, 1942 in Dayton, OH, passed away June 18, 2015 and reunited with her parents, Steve and Eileen Joefreda and granddaughter, Taylor. She was a loving wife, mother, grandmother, sister, and employee of GMAC. She is survived by her husband of 27 years, Jack Johns; brothers, Jerry Joefreda (Cindy), Dave Joefreda (Tammy); daughter, Kim Kutach (Robert); stepson, Jack Johns Jr. (Christina); stepdaughter, Sherry Contreras; grandchildren: Angie (Eric), Trey, Sean, Christa, Casey, Christian, Hayley, and great grandson, Cameron.
Services will be held 11am,Saturday, June 27th, at Second Baptist Church of Kingwood. For more information about the life of Judy or to sign the online guest book DarstFuneralHome.com
